staging: wlan-ng: use netdev_() instead of printk()
Replaced all uses of printk() in wlan-ng with netdev_err / _warn
where a netdev exists. If a few cases where a netdev does not yet
exist, dev_ or pr_ was used.
Checkpatch complains about lines over 80 chars or split string
constants - the messages are just too long, keeping it completely
happy would make the code less readable.
